Web23 jul. 2024 · The main difference between bacteria and fungi is that bacteria are unicellular prokaryotic organisms whereas fungi are multicellular eukaryotic organisms. Both bacteria and fungi contain DNA as their genetic material. Are fungi and bacteria autotrophic? Algae along with plants and some bacteria and fungi are autotrophs. WebAlgae also cannot live on dead organic material; rather, they need water to thrive and grow. Some other key differences are: Algae often have cell walls made of cellulose, while fungi have cell walls made of chitin. Fungi are further classified into groups such as moulds and yeasts, while algae is only divided into three main groups. Fungi are ...

Web24 mei 2024 · Chytridiomycota, often referred to as chytrids, are a group of saprotrophic and necrotrophic fungi widespread in both aquatic and terrestrial environments [ 24 ]. In marine habitats, they have been recognized as important microalgae parasites, able to influence algal bloom dynamics [ 25 ].

WebKey points: The two prokaryote domains, Bacteria and Archaea, split from each other early in the evolution of life. Bacteria are very diverse, ranging from disease-causing pathogens to beneficial photosynthesizers and symbionts.
